Afghan Taliban Warns Pakistan of Response to Any Aggression Amid Rising Tensions

Analysed 16 Aug 2026·2 sources analysed·Pakistan·Politics
Afghan Taliban Warns Pakistan of Response to Any Aggression Amid Rising TensionsPreviousNext

Afghanistan's Taliban Defense Minister Mullah Mohammad Yaqoob Mujahid warned Pakistan of a measured but firm response to any aggression against Afghan territory amid escalating tensions. The warning follows ongoing disputes over cross-border security and militant activity, including Pakistan's airstrikes targeting groups like the Tehrik-e-Taliban Pakistan. The Taliban denies harboring these militants but signals readiness to defend its sovereignty, raising concerns about potential further conflict between the neighboring countries.
